mirror of
https://github.com/discourse/discourse.git
synced 2025-05-26 11:32:11 +08:00
DEV: Revert rails 7.1 upgrade (#27522)
* Revert "FIX: Set `override_level` on Logster loggers (#27519)" This reverts commit c1b0488c547bca935de51cfbb86bbc528e9ab2e5. * Revert "DEV: Make parameters optional to all FakeLogger methods" This reverts commit 3318dad7b4e3365854319bb55301cf667a2c28d0. * Revert "FIX: Remove references to `Rails.logger.chained`" This reverts commit f595d599dd361b7fb39fb3c82cbc11d19d518c19. * Revert "DEV: Upgrade Rails to 7.1" This reverts commit 081b00391e47a7f9bc44b9fe8ce88ac97d728352.
This commit is contained in:
@ -14,7 +14,7 @@ RSpec.describe Hijack do
|
||||
self.request = ActionController::TestRequest.new(env, nil, nil)
|
||||
|
||||
# we need this for the 418
|
||||
set_response!(ActionDispatch::Response.new)
|
||||
self.response = ActionDispatch::Response.new
|
||||
end
|
||||
|
||||
def hijack_test(&blk)
|
||||
@ -22,10 +22,12 @@ RSpec.describe Hijack do
|
||||
end
|
||||
end
|
||||
|
||||
let(:tester) { Hijack::Tester.new }
|
||||
let :tester do
|
||||
Hijack::Tester.new
|
||||
end
|
||||
|
||||
describe "Request Tracker integration" do
|
||||
let(:logger) do
|
||||
let :logger do
|
||||
lambda do |env, data|
|
||||
@calls += 1
|
||||
@status = data[:status]
|
||||
@ -179,7 +181,7 @@ RSpec.describe Hijack do
|
||||
end
|
||||
|
||||
result =
|
||||
"HTTP/1.1 302 Found\r\nLocation: http://awesome.com\r\nContent-Type: text/html; charset=utf-8\r\nContent-Length: 0\r\nConnection: close\r\nX-Runtime: 1.000000\r\n\r\n"
|
||||
"HTTP/1.1 302 Found\r\nLocation: http://awesome.com\r\nContent-Type: text/html; charset=utf-8\r\nContent-Length: 84\r\nConnection: close\r\nX-Runtime: 1.000000\r\n\r\n<html><body>You are being <a href=\"http://awesome.com\">redirected</a>.</body></html>"
|
||||
expect(tester.io.string).to eq(result)
|
||||
end
|
||||
|
||||
|
Reference in New Issue
Block a user